Hasktorch is a powerful Haskell library for tensor computation and neural network modeling, built on top of libtorch (the backend of PyTorch). It brings differentiable programming, automatic differentiation, and efficient tensor operations into Haskell’s strongly typed functional paradigm. This project is in active development, so expect changes to the library API as it evolves. We would like to invite new users to join our Hasktorch discord space for questions and discussions. Contributions/PR are encouraged. Hasktorch is a library for tensors and neural networks in Haskell. It is an independent open source community project which leverages the core C++ libraries shared by PyTorch.
Features
- High-performance tensor operations utilizing libtorch for CPU and GPU computation
- Support for both typed and untyped tensors to ensure type safety and flexibility
- Automatic differentiation for gradient-based optimization and learning
- Abundant mathematical operations including linear algebra, neural network layers, and probability distributions
- Lightweight, idiomatic Haskell design leveraging algebraic data types and functional composition
- Active open-source community with tutorials, examples, and multi-platform support (Linux, macOS, Nix, Docker)
